青岛市大气环境容量及总量控制研究

Study of the Atmospheric Environmental Capacity and Total Control in Qingdao

【作者】 秦娟娟

【导师】 程建光; 王静;

【作者基本信息】 山东科技大学 , 环境工程, 2011, 硕士

【摘要】 大气环境容量的研究确定是有效控制大气环境污染、改善环境质量的基础,是各级政府制定大气污染防治措施的主要依据之一。对于制定环境管理计划和环境规划,实施总量控制和排污许可,科学合理利用大气环境资源,优化促进区域经济健康持续发展,建设资源节约、环境友好型社会,具有十分重要的意义和作用。通过对污染源的调查与分析,确定主要污染物,利用GIS对青岛市大气功能区进行划分,在此基础上测算各主要污染物的大气环境容量,依据测算的大气环境容量,制定大气污染物总量控制方案,既可确保总量削减,又可充分利用环境容量资源,为提高青岛市的环境管理水平和促进青岛市持续发展提供依据。论文研究内容主要包括以下几方面:(1)资料收集,开展大气环境现状调查,摸清现阶段青岛市大气污染状况,确定测算因子;根据收集的资料,通过对各种大气环境容量测算方法的分析了解,选择A-P值法测算大气环境容量;(2)在对青岛市的经济发展、资源和环境等方面进行系统分析后,利用GIS空间分析功能,对青岛市大气功能区进行划分,并对A值进行修正,以计算大气环境容量;(3)结合青岛市大气污染现状,大气环境容量,环境质量标准等,提出污染物总量控制方案,为青岛市经济、资源可持续发展决策提供科学依据。

【Abstract】 The research of atmospheric environmental capacity is the foundation of effective control of air pollution and improve environmental quanlity, and is also one of the main bases for governments to formulate air pollution control measures. It has great significane and effect for making environmental management plan and environmental planning, and implementation of total volume control and pollution permits, and the scientific and rational utilization of atmospheric environmental resources, and promoting regional economy sustainable development and building a resource-conserving and environment-friendly society.The main pollutants are determined through the investigation and analysis of pollution source and the Qingdao atmospheric functional areas are classified by using GIS. Estimate the atmospheric environmental capacity on the basis of the that and formulate atmospheric pollutant control scheme, which can ensure the reducing total amount of pollutants and make full use of environmental capacity resource for improving environmental management level and promoting the sustainable development of Qingdao.In this paper, the main works are as follows:(1)Collecting data, figuring the atmospheric pollution situation of Qingdao at present, and determining the calculated factors. Using the A-P method to estimate the atmospheric environmental capacity according to the collection datas and the analysis of estimation methods.(2)Dividing the atmospheric functional zone by using the spacial analysis of GIS after the system analysis of economic development, resources and environment and amending the value of A for estimating the atmospheric environmental capacity.(3)Put forward the scheme of total emission control combined with the present situation of atmospheric contamination in Qingdao city, atmospheric environmental capacity and environmental quality standards. Provide scientific evidence for Qingdao economic and resources sustainable development decisions.
